Page 2: R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ES

R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ES

Conducts applied research to match with real life needs.

Develops practical solutions together with the authorities and enterprises.

Supports teaching and training.

Page 3: R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ES

R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ES Currently 14 people are directly employed in

development projects (e.g. environment, safety, operational efficiency).

Networked with Finnish and international research institutions and universities.

Depending on the project the relative share of EU funding, Finnish public funding and private funding from companies varies.

Page 8: R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ES

TANKER SIMULATOR

♦ Put into service 2004♦ Eight student work stations with two screens ♦ Possibility to train cargo operations in crude oil, chemical/product and gas carriers

Page 9: R&D AT THE MARITIME STUDIES

TERMINAL SIMULATOR♦ SIMOILI-project got started 31.3. 2004 ♦ Three student work stations with four screens ♦ Possibility to train terminal operations with crude oil and chemicl/product carriers♦ Will be connected to function together with the Tanker Simulator
